Pediatricians and development experts have strongly urged parents, once again, to limit the amount of television their young children watch.
The American Academy of Pediatrics released a recommendation to all parents of children under 2 years old Tuesday. It stressed that any time spent in front of a video screen provides no educational benefits for children under age 2 and can even delay developm
